Sauber has become the fourth team to reveal their 2018 car, the C37, featuring an all-new livery as part of their new partnership with Alfa Romeo.

The Swiss team endured a difficult season last year, slipping to the bottom of the constructors' championship and scoring just five points but, with the Hinwil operation gathering speed after recent problems and the latest Ferrari engine, expectations are high for a much improved year ahead.

Alfa's return to Formula 1 for the first time in 33 years as title sponsor and technical partner is part of the enhanced relationship with Ferrari, with both brands coming under the Fiat umbrella, as is the arrival of F2 champion Charles Leclerc alongside Marcus Ericsson.

Team principal Fred Vasseur suggested last year that very little of last year's design would be carried over to 2018 and certainly, the C37 does look a step forward from last year, although compared to the other cars seen so far, the Sauber is the most basic.
